In this book, Tim O'Reilly explores how technology and innovation are reshaping the economy, society, and the future of work. He argues that understanding the patterns behind technological disruption can help us build a better future, emphasizing the importance of adaptability, ethical responsibility, and long-term thinking in the face of rapid change.

About Tim O'Reilly

Tim O'Reilly is the founder and CEO of O'Reilly Media, a leading publisher and technology conference organizer. He is known for popularizing terms such as 'open source' and 'Web 2.0' and for his influential role in shaping the technology industry through his writing and advocacy.
